( April 11th, 2024) WebOct 9, 2024 · Entries linking to cryo-. Proto-Indo-European root meaning "to begin to freeze, form a crust." It forms all or part of: crouton; crust; Crustacea; crustacean; cryo-; …

WebMar 26, 2016 · Herpes comes from the Greek word herpo, meaning “to creep along.” It is descriptive of the course and type of skin lesion as with herpes zoster (shingles). WebUsage. acclaim. When you acclaim the deeds of someone, you praise them highly and approve of them enthusiastically. disclaimer. A disclaimer is a legal statement that declares a refusal to accept responsibility in case something bad happens when a product is used.
